Maldon District Council is seeking to employ a qualified and experienced Environmental Health Manager (Protection) to work within our busy, multi-skilled service for an initial 3-month period. The post holder will be expected to provide clear direction and effective leadership, setting service priorities, monitoring work allocation and improving overall performance. They must provide technical advice and decision making in all aspects of the role, including taking formal action where applicable.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ide effective leadership for a team of Environmental Health Officers, Technical Officers and Administration Officers, overseeing service priorities, work allocation and performance reporting
- Provide day-to-day operational management of direct reports, following HR policies and processes
- Deliver customer-focused specialist advice and services, ensuring the provision of professional services that meet customers’ needs
- Act as the single point of contact for environmental protection relation queries and complaints
- Support, guide and advise the multi-skilled environmental protection team on complex cases related to the specialism
- Work collaboratively with colleagues across the organisation and support effective working relationships with elected members, partners and other stakeholders
- Have a deeper understanding of Environmental Health Services, enabling resolution of a broader range of more complex cases, applications and inspections and providing resilience and flexibility within the team
- Ensure effective 2-way communication and feedback is promoted across all teams and important management updates are shared where appropriate
- Encourage praise, peer to peer feedback and recognition of achievements within the teams
The Experience you will bring:
We are looking for someone who is ideally registered with the Chartered Institute of Environmental Health with significant experience in Environmental Health and 2+ years line management.
